About the Community

Bucks County, Pennsylvania offers a unique blend of historic charm, vibrant communities, and natural beauty. Located just north of Philadelphia along the Delaware River, the area is known for its walkable boroughs, strong schools, and deep sense of civic and community life. From colonial-era towns and preserved open spaces to thriving arts, cultural, and faith communities, Bucks County balances tradition with thoughtful growth.
 

Morrisville and its neighboring boroughs—such as Yardley and Lower Makefield—are close-knit, family-friendly communities where relationships matter and neighbors know one another. Residents enjoy access to riverside parks, local shops and restaurants, community events, and an active volunteer spirit. The area is well-connected by rail and road, making it easy to reach Philadelphia, New York City, and the surrounding region, while still offering a slower, more grounded pace of life.

Morrisville Borough

Morrisville stands apart from the broader Bucks County community as a historic, walkable riverfront borough with a more urban feel than the surrounding suburban townships. Its compact size and diverse population foster close relationships and a strong sense of neighborhood identity, creating a ministry context that is relational, grounded, and closely connected to the wider region.

Lower Makefield Township

Lower Makefield Township is a primarily residential, suburban community just north of Morrisville, known for its strong schools, parks, and family-oriented neighborhoods. While Morrisville is home to Morrisville Presbyterian Church, the majority of MPC’s membership lives in Lower Makefield, reflecting the close connection between the church and the surrounding community.

Yardley Borough

Yardley Borough is a historic, walkable river town just north of Morrisville, known for its charming downtown, local shops, and active community life. Many MPC members live in or frequent Yardley, making it an important part of the broader community connected to Morrisville Presbyterian Church.
